BANGALORE, July 22: The Indian Space Research Organisation ISRO and the Indian Institute of Science have launched a collaborative educational and research programme on 8216;Satellite Technology and its Applications8217;. The programme aims at developing scientific and technical manpower needed for space projects and to upgrade the knowledge of inservice scientists and engineers involved in space programmes. The programme also envisages collaboration with the International Space University, Strasbourg, France.
